All sectors without LULUCF — Emissions (CO2eq) from N2O in Benin
Benin: All sectors without LULUCF — Emissions (CO2eq) from N2O was 3,204 kt in 2023. ▲ Rising
All sectors without LULUCF — Emissions (CO2eq) from N2O in Benin, 1990–2023
Source: Food and Agriculture Organization of the United Nations. Measured in kt.
Analysis
Benin recorded 3,204 kt for all sectors without lulucf — emissions (co2eq) from n2o in 2023. That is the highest value across all 34 years on record.
The figure is up 6.1% on the previous year and up 39.4% over ten years.
Over the whole period, all sectors without lulucf — emissions (co2eq) from n2o in Benin peaked at 3,204 kt in 2023 and was at its lowest, 1,445 kt, in 1990.
That places Benin 96th out of 222 countries with data for 2023, putting it in the middle of the range.
The long-run direction has been consistently rising across the 34 years of available data.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
